• Модуль: imopenlines
  • Путь к файлу: ~/bitrix/modules/imopenlines/lib/integrations/report/handlers/treatment.php
  • Класс: BitrixImOpenLinesIntegrationsReportHandlersfor
  • Вызов: for::getWhatWillCalculateOptions
public function getWhatWillCalculateOptions($groupBy = null)
{
	if ($this->getView()->getKey() === 'activity')
	{
		return array(
			self::WHAT_WILL_CALCULATE_ALL_TREATMENT_BY_HOUR => Loc::getMessage('WHAT_WILL_CALCULATE_ALL_TREATMENT_BY_HOUR'),
		);
	}
	return array(
		self::WHAT_WILL_CALCULATE_ALL => Loc::getMessage('WHAT_WILL_CALCULATE_ALL_TREATMENT'),
		self::WHAT_WILL_CALCULATE_ALL_TREATMENT_BY_HOUR => Loc::getMessage('WHAT_WILL_CALCULATE_ALL_TREATMENT_BY_HOUR'),
		self::WHAT_WILL_CALCULATE_FIRST => Loc::getMessage('WHAT_WILL_CALCULATE_FIRST_TREATMENT_NEW'),
		self::WHAT_WILL_CALCULATE_DUPLICATE => Loc::getMessage('WHAT_WILL_CALCULATE_DUPLICATE_TREATMENT_NEW'),
		self::WHAT_WILL_CALCULATE_POSITIVE_MARK => Loc::getMessage('WHAT_WILL_CALCULATE_POSITIVE_MARK'),
		self::WHAT_WILL_CALCULATE_NEGATIVE_MARK => Loc::getMessage('WHAT_WILL_CALCULATE_NEGATIVE_MARK'),
		self::WHAT_WILL_CALCULATE_WITHOUT_MARK => Loc::getMessage('WHAT_WILL_CALCULATE_WITHOUT_MARK'),
		self::WHAT_WILL_CALCULATE_ALL_MARK => Loc::getMessage('WHAT_WILL_CALCULATE_ALL_MARK'),
		self::WHAT_WILL_CALCULATE_ALL_APPOINTED => Loc::getMessage("WHAT_WILL_CALCULATE_ALL_APPOINTED"),
		self::WHAT_WILL_CALCULATE_ANSWERED => Loc::getMessage("WHAT_WILL_CALCULATE_ANSWERED"),
		self::WHAT_WILL_CALCULATE_SKIPPED => Loc::getMessage("WHAT_WILL_CALCULATE_SKIPPED"),
		self::WHAT_WILL_CALCULATE_CONTENTMENT => Loc::getMessage('WHAT_WILL_CALCULATE_CONTENTMENT'),
	);
}